Output d947e626cc7ee7a03e99daeb43beec3d7d713b9020c91e6a00c4cebfa84fd5ed:58

value
296498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ac3ba515b079bce4244eea8e09f874c936a7b8d OP_EQUAL
address
3ELjeRToyg73mPqANsL5ndHH3nPWgLCCqV
transaction
d947e626cc7ee7a03e99daeb43beec3d7d713b9020c91e6a00c4cebfa84fd5ed
spent
true